Why Use Prompt Templates in Program Management?

Prompt templates serve as standardized frameworks that guide team members in generating consistent and high-quality outputs. They help reduce ambiguity, streamline workflows, and ensure that all critical aspects of a project are addressed systematically.

Benefits of Proven Prompt Templates

  • Consistency: Maintain uniformity across reports, updates, and communications.
  • Efficiency: Save time by providing clear starting points for various tasks.
  • Clarity: Ensure all team members understand expectations and deliverables.
  • Quality Improvement: Enhance the accuracy and depth of outputs through structured prompts.

Examples of Effective Prompt Templates

Project Status Update

Use this template to gather concise and comprehensive project updates:

Prompt: “Provide a summary of the current status of [Project Name], including completed milestones, upcoming tasks, challenges faced, and any support needed.”

Risk Assessment

This template helps identify potential risks early:

Prompt: “Identify potential risks associated with [Project Name], assess their impact and likelihood, and suggest mitigation strategies.”
